WPA Mixed
WPA Mixed
is the security mode which permits the coexistence of WPA and WPA2 clients
on a WLAN. When the wireless security is set in this mode, the wireless client device can
connect to the Residential Gateway with WPA/TKIP or WPA2/AES. Some older wireless
client devices only support WPA/TKIP. So you have to select the mixed mode to open the
WiFi service to this device.

RADIUS Sever IP Address
-
Specify the IP address of the RADIUS server in
the text box.
RADIUS Server Port
-
Specify the port number of the RADIUS server in the
text box. The default value is 1812.
